North Dakota releases 8 bighorn sheep hunting licenses for 2025
BISMARCK, ND (KXNET) — The North Dakota Game and Fish Department has allocated eight highly coveted Bighorn sheep hunting licenses for the 2025 season. These one-in-a-lifetime licenses are one more than the seven provided during last year's seasons. Hunters were required to apply for a bighorn license earlier this year on the bighorn sheep, moose and elk application. Here are the 2025 North Dakota bighorn sheep license recipients
BISMARCK – The North Dakota Game and Fish Department allocated eight bighorn sheep licenses for the 2025 hunting season, one more than last year. Two of those licenses went to Grand Forks hunters. In a news release Thursday, Sept. 4, the department said it issued one license in Unit B1, one in B2, one in B3, three in B4 and one in B5.
